Inspirational Books
The Dalai Lama and Desmond Tutu provide us a gentle, laughter-filled exploration of how joy and resilience can coexist even in hardship – and the power we have to cultivate both.
Brené Brown reframes vulnerability as a leadership superpower and an essential ingredient for wholehearted, resilient living – both personally and professionally.
Angela Duckworth authored this powerful reminder that sustained, intentional effort is what drives meaningful success in our lives – not perfection or pure, natural ability.
A modern call from Cal Newport to reject the depletion of hustle culture and to embrace depth, quality, intentionality, and sustainable success in both life and leadership.
Marta Beck wrote this compassionate guide to rediscovering your true self and navigating your way back to a life of purpose and inner peace grounded in our core values and what energizes us from within.
A thoughtful and deeply moving invitation from Adam Grant to challenge our assumptions, loosen our grip on rigid thinking, embrace courageous curiosity, and create the space for growth and connection.
Motivational Talks
In this fast-moving and entertaining talk, psychologist Shawn Achor argues how cultivating happiness inspires productivity.
In this poignant and funny talk, Brené Brown explains how embracing open vulnerability is the secret to connection.
In this talk, Robert Waldinger shares three important lessons and practical wisdom on how to build a fulfilling, long life.
Meg Jay outlines courageous questions to ask about how your present and future can align, so you can begin to achieve your goals.
Autl Gawande – author and surgeon – shares how the best way to become great is to find yourself a coach you trust.
